Norella Street, Chula Vista on the map

Home > States > California > Chula Vista > Norella Street

Chula Vista, Norella Street. Online map.

Norella Streeton the interactive online map Chula Vista. Chula Vista, Norella Street. Search on the map, closest way, distance to the Norella Street. Simple and easy to use on mobile devices.